Dhaka, Sept. 28 -- The weeklong solo photography exhibition "Echoes of Peace" by internationally acclaimed Bangladeshi photographer Muhammad Mostafigur Rahman came to a close in New York. Organized to mark the International Day of Peace, the exhibition was held at the Save the People Auditorium of the Peace Center on Hillside Avenue, Jamaica.
Featuring forty striking photographs, the exhibition captured the beauty of Bangladesh's nature, culture, rural life, human struggles, and interfaith harmony. Each image carried a message of peace and humanity, leaving visitors deeply moved and inspired.
